Definitions:

Sales Account

An account in the general ledger that records the revenue generated from goods and services sold by a company during a specific period.

Defective

Pertaining to a product or component that has a flaw or imperfection that prevents it from functioning as intended.

Operating Cycle

The time period it takes for a company to purchase inventory, sell it, and convert the sale into cash.

Merchandising Company

A company that purchases and sells tangible inventory to customers without changing its form.
